One potential factor involves your body’s natural production of growth hormone. As you age, your pituitary gland produces less of this essential hormone. This impacts many functions, from muscle maintenance to metabolism. A specific treatment called Sermorelin Telehealth offers a way to naturally support your body.
This compounded prescription is a growth hormone-releasing hormone (GHRH) analog. It works by stimulating your own pituitary gland. Instead of introducing external growth hormone, it encourages your body to release its own. This happens in a natural, pulsatile manner, mimicking your body’s physiological rhythm. It offers a subtle, supportive approach.
This therapy aims to restore more youthful levels of growth hormone. Consequently, your body may produce more IGF-1, a key marker. This supports various bodily systems. It is important to understand that compounded Sermorelin is not FDA-approved. It is dispensed by compounding pharmacies under sections 503A and 503B of the Federal Food, Drug, and Cosmetic Act. These sections allow pharmacists to prepare customized medications. They meet specific patient needs when a commercial drug is unavailable or unsuitable.

Sermorelin works on a slow curve because it asks the body to make its own growth hormone. Results compound over months, not days. A typical reported timeline looks like this.

Weeks 1 to 4
Deeper sleep is usually the first signal. Morning energy lifts. Recovery from training feels faster. No measurable body composition change yet.
Weeks 5 to 8
Skin texture, hair quality and nail strength tend to shift. Mental clarity in the afternoon improves. Strength on lifts often goes up.
Weeks 9 to 12
Body composition starts moving, with a typical 5 to 10 percent fat reduction reported alongside small lean mass gains. Libido and joint comfort improve.
Month 4 and beyond
A follow-up IGF-1 lab is drawn. Dose is adjusted up or down. Many patients maintain on a lower dose after this point.

Reported side effects are generally mild and include injection site redness, transient flushing and occasional headache. Sermorelin uses your own pituitary gland, which tends to be safer than synthetic HGH because the body retains its natural feedback loop.
